A special highlight of the celebration was the introduction of the Worry Monster — a fun and creative emotional wellness tool. Learners wrote down their worries and “fed” them to the monster, symbolically letting go of their anxieties in a safe and supportive space. This engaging activity helped children express their feelings freely and learn that sharing can lighten emotional burdens.
